Instill financial responsibility in your young adult children by requiring them to move out and handle their bills on their own as soon as possible after college graduation. I kicked my kid out of my house — and you can, too.

Kicking your kid out of the house doesn't necessarily mean that you won't offer some initial help, but it does mean that they will be responsible for personally paying all of their housing bills. And as parents we can help there, as well, by showing our kids how to establish credit.

I am betting that many of you who have become financially successful achieved that status because you worked hard and took responsibility early in life. Of course, all of us want to help our children. However, letting them know there is always a "Plan B" will never really help them find their own way.
